Program Description
The Master of Public Administration program is accredited by the National Association of Schools of Public Affairs and Administration (NASPAA) and is designed to prepare graduates for middle or senior level positions as public administrators. The primary focus of the program is on in-service students seeking to undertake graduate study on a part-time basis in order to upgrade and improve their practical skills and theoretical backgrounds. These students come from municipal, county, state, and non-profit agencies in the region served by Kean University. Each year a small number of students are admitted without extensive government experience.
ADMISSION REQUIREMENTS
In addition to the University’s admission requirements:
- Baccalaureate degree from an accredited college or university
- Cumulative grade point average (GPA) of 3.0 (lower GPA’s will be considered based on overall strength of application
- Official transcripts from all institutions attended
- Two letters of recommendation
- Departmental interview may be required
- Personal statement
- Writing sample
- Professional Resume/CV
- TOEFL (for applicants whose native language is not English)
PROGRAM REQUIREMENTS
- 21 credits in foundation courses
- 18 credits in electives
- 3 credit culminating research seminar
- 6 credit internship (may be waived for students with appropriate experience)
